This is a Compliance Technician role required within a growing business to ensure technical orientated programmes & assets conform to the latest standards. The successful candidate will be able to demonstrate a practical approach to technical documentation analysis, with a proven track record in delivering detailed programme reports. As the Compliance technician you will be the bridge between internal development & client requirements, ensuring programmes conform to governing guidelines. As part of the compliance team, the role will be under the guidance of senior compliance manager with great opportunities for career progression.
Responsibilities
- Review client Statements of Work and Technical Requirement Specification, generating a concise scope of compliance targets.
- Compile & maintain compliance matrices throughout the lifecycle of projects/programmes, liaising with the relevant stakeholders to assure agreement.
- Knowledge of latest industry compliance/safety requirements, coordinating with government officials for updated standards.
- Key strategist for identifying project demands, resolving project uncertainty through compliance & safety assessment for programme risk reduction.
- Assist in the review and presentation of product assurance for milestone delivery.
- Support effective transfer of new products into steady state manufacturing.
- Support ongoing asset lifecycles.
Qualifications
- A relevant technical focused degree (Scientific, Engineering, Mathematics).
- 1 – 2 years industry experience preferred.
- Technically orientated individual with high aptitude for detail.
- Demonstrated experience literature reviews, complex reports review & delivery.
- Knowledge of STANAG / MIL-STD / AOP desirable.
- Appetite for learning and career progression.

Company Overview
Teledyne Energetics UK have been designing and developing solutions for the safety, arming, and initiation technology sector since 1984. This includes military energetic devices from components through to complete systems. Some of the flagship product lines include active vehicle safety systems, sea mine fuzes, modular artillery fuzes, flight termination units, electronic Safe & Arm Units, and electronic Ignition Safety Devices. Originally part of the Teledyne e2v family, Teledyne Energetics also delivers a range of services to its global customer base. Design services include modelling and testing of fully packaged circuitry for control and initiation of detonators, which are carried out at our fully licensed site at Lincoln.
